Jimena Sánchez Mejía Reyes, widely known by her professional name Jimena Sánchez, has established herself as a prominent Mexican sports journalist, television host, model, and former actress, renowned for her engaging coverage of wrestling, NFL, and MLB on Fox Sports Mexico.

With a career that blends sharp commentary, on-screen charisma, and advocacy against sexism in sports media, she first gained traction through a bold photoblog before anchoring hits like Lo Mejor de Fox Sports and WWE Saturday Night.

Career

Jimena Sánchez Mejía Reyes kicked off her professional path in 2008 by co-launching the photoblog Mad Mamacitas with her best friend Hannah Sotelo, a daring platform of stylish, near-nude self-portraits that quickly drew attention for her bold aesthetic and resemblance to high-profile figures, turning heads and building her initial online buzz.

This led to writing gigs at Mexico’s top sports outlets, where she penned weekly columns and video blogs for RÉCORD magazine and the website Medio Tiempo, sharpening her voice on topics like soccer and baseball while blending glamour with game analysis.

By 2011, her fresh take landed her a contract with Fox Sports Latin America, starting with the entertainment show Fox Para Todos, which marked her seamless shift from print to on-air presence and set the foundation for her sports media empire.

Her growth accelerated through diverse hosting roles at Fox, where she tackled wrestling with WWE Saturday Night alongside Vero Rodríguez, delivering play-by-play excitement that hooked fans across Latin America, while her NFL coverage on Fox Impacto—launching Thursday Night Football segments in 2019—earned her a rep for insightful breakdowns of plays and player stories.

She expanded into MLB reporting, covering key games and trades with the same infectious energy, and in 2017 co-founded Versus, a nonprofit aimed at fighting gender bias in sports journalism, spotlighting the sexist trolls she and colleagues like Marion Reimers faced online.

These efforts not only boosted her profile but highlighted her commitment to inclusivity, turning potential backlash into a platform for change amid her rising stardom.

Personal Life

Jimena Sánchez Mejía Reyes embraced matrimony with singer-songwriter Tis Zombie on October 1, 2021, after their romance ignited in February of that year.

Before him, she shared a past with Mexican TV presenter Faisy Omar.

With no children in the picture, the pair focuses on building a blended life in Mexico City, where she unwinds with yoga flows, tattoo sessions that nod to her faith, and cheering her teams—the Oakland Raiders, New York Yankees, and LA Lakers—from the stands or couch.
